The sides of a square are 3^2/7 inches long. What is the area of the square?

A. 9^4/7 square inches

B. 3^4/7 square inches

C. 3^4/49 square inches

D. 9^4/49 square inches

The area is (3^{2/7} )^2[/tex], or (3^2/7)*(3^2/7). Then you add the exponents: 3^(2/7+2/7) or 3^4/7,Therefore, yes, the answer is B, three to the power of four sevenths square inches.
